Transaction 764fa2dac17242dbc76aa99c92a7068f626fdefeb10d6841ceae118feee2cf9b
1 Input
2 Outputs
- 764fa2dac17242dbc76aa99c92a7068f626fdefeb10d6841ceae118feee2cf9b:0
- 764fa2dac17242dbc76aa99c92a7068f626fdefeb10d6841ceae118feee2cf9b:1
value 10908800
address 1PJC4jE7s2B6WfrDWgECJmuvUU3bCCT2mm
value 1469089618
address 1FJSMqwUK447jSepPU6wEpYY8TS69WPkms